There's no reason why one could not have a chain of FSMs. You get the exact
same behavior with less framework code.
The reason why MINA 1 and 2 has a chain is unclear. One possible explainaition is that
MINA was supposed to implement the SEDA>architecture (each filter communicate with
the next filter using a queue, and as this architecture is supposed to spread filters on
more than>one computer, then it's easier to implement it using a chain. Well, that's
my perception. One other reason was the lack of vision about the>possible use cases.
6 years in restrospect, I do think that this need never surfaced...

I modified the API to remove IoFilterChain. Now you are supposed to
give a list of filter to the service before starting it :
// create the fitler chain for this service
List<IoFilter> filters = new ArrayList<IoFilter>();
filters.add(new LoggingFilter("byte log filter"));
filters.add(new MyCodecFilter());
filters.add(new LoggingFilter("pojo log filter"));
filters.add(newMyProtocolLogicFilter());
acceptor.setFilters(filters);
I would like to have something like :
acceptor.addFilters(
new LoggingFilter("byte log filter"),
new MyCodecFilter(),
new LoggingFilter("pojo log filter"),
newMyProtocolLogicFilter() )
which is easy as soon as we have a Acceptor.addFilters( Filter...
filters ) method. (ellipsis notation is really very comfy)
